COVID Safe Activities: Week 3
We’ve moved into November, and it’s getting chilly!
As we stay indoors more with this colder weather it is more challenging to stay busy and happy while also staying safe.
One of Nick’s favorite things to do when it gets colder is to grab a warm blanket and a cozy pillow and watch some of his favorite movies. Movie nights are a great way to relax, and you can also invite vaccinated friends over to watch with you!
With the holidays coming up, now is a great time to stay indoors and practice your baking! Not only will the oven help keep the house warm, but you’ll have a tasty treat to share with friends or to eat during your movie night.
Nick’s favorite thing to make is cheesecake! He loves making cheesecake for his family and friends for special occasions or just because. You can adapt recipes to fit so many different dietary restrictions too.
Cooking and baking is a great way to get some sensory stimulation!
Winter will be here soon, and Nick is looking forward to more movie nights and baking more tasty treats. Nick says his favorite part of the holidays is how much good food people get to eat. He can’t wait for Thanksgiving and Christmas!
What will you do this season to stay happy and healthy?
COVID Safe Activities Week One
Unfortunately, it looks like COVID-19 cases are ramping up this fall, and we can expect to be extra cautious again this year to protect ourselves and our families and friends. Nick wants to publish some ideas each week for fun, COVID safe activities. Staying busy while staying safe can be fun!
Nick loves being able to have some guy time, and with football finally back this year, what better excuse is there? Having a couple of vaccinated friends come over to cheer on your favorite team and eat some tasty food is a wonderful way to have some safe fun.
Nick’s favorite team is the Denver Broncos, but he enjoys the quality time spent with friends even more than the game. Recently Nick invited his friends Alex and Jonas over to have a game day BBQ. Everyone had so much fun and Nick was very happy to be able to spend the weekend with friends and catch up. Go Broncos!
Another good idea for some COVID safe fun is to get outside while the weather is still nice! Nick enjoys going to the Benson Sculpture Park in Loveland to look at the sculptures. The park is beautiful, and Nick especially loves all the animal sculptures. Walking outside is a great way to keep your distance from others while still enjoying some fresh air.
Nick loves going bird watching with his job coach Audrey and her family. Bird watching with Audrey is a tradition Nick has enjoyed for years. Nick’s favorite part about bird watching is when furry friends come along for the fun, even if it gets a little crazy! Walking your dogs with family or friends is a great way to get some exercise and stay safe.
